The Darwish brothers fled Baghdad to Israel in
the 1950s and established Fantasia - a menorah factory in
Tel Aviv's industrial zone. Stirred by the bombing of Baghdad and Tel
Aviv in the Gulf War of 1991, director Duki Dror - the son of the youngest
of the three brothers - retraces his Iraqi roots. Faced with the reclusive
silence of his father, Dror digs up bits of information about the family's
past. Finally, his reluctant father divulges a long kept secret. A revelatory
family portrait that balances humor with pain. More info
